The Business Knowledge Development (BKD) Training Specialist is responsible for delivering onboarding training and other training related to the Business Knowledge Development area. This role manages the full training cycle: from content creation and session organisation to training delivery, feedback collection, assessments, reporting and continuous content improvement.
You will:- Designing, developing, and delivering online and offline onboarding and other business knowledge training sessions, in line with training plans.
- Create and maintain learning content (decks, handbooks, infographics, e-learning courses, videos etc), leveraging AI-based and other design tools to optimise learning content creation and personalisation and create visually compelling training materials.
- In collaboration with SME ensure all content complies with company standards, adult learning principles, and remains engaging and accessible.
- Conduct surveys, gather participant feedback, and analyze assessment results to evaluate training effectiveness and identify improvements
- Update and improve content based on learner feedback, process changes, or strategic goals.
- Identify knowledge gaps and propose appropriate training interventions.
- Track participation and completion; maintain accurate records of training hours and outcomes.
- Supporting projects on any learning & development assignments as required, supporting business improvement and sustaining change;
- Perform other ad-hoc tasks as assigned by the Head of Business Knowledge Development.

Exness Group is a global multi-asset broker that was founded in 2008 with the mission to reshape the online trading industry. We aim to maximize our client's potential when trading the markets by offering better-than-market conditions on currencies, crypto, stocks, indices, metals, and commodities.Our fresh scientific and ethical approach has resonated with traders around the world, and the company has gone from strength to strength, with trading volumes hitting new monthly records in 2023 at $3 trillion from an active client base of 414,502+We think business and act human. Our growing #ExnessFamily has more than 2,000 employees in offices located in Asia and Europe.
